Yvette is a vampire who appears in the second part of Breaking Dawn. Along with Henri, she is a member of the French coven. She is an exclusive character in the movies and does not exist in the novels.

Biography

They eventually find out that the supposed immortal child is a half-human half-vampire hybrid. When Aro explains that the child poses a threat to exposing their secret to mankind, Yvette and her mate seem easily persuaded, but when another hybrid, Nahuel, describes his traits and how he has managed to stay hidden in their world, Aro declares that the child poses no threat to them after all. After the situation was cleared peacefully, Yvette and her mate move on their way.
Physical appearance
Yvette is noted to have curly dark-brown hair and a head shorter than her mate Henri.

Janelle describes her character as a "French bad-girl vampire".[1]
